“ Florida A & M University ( FAMU ) College of Law joins the City of Orlando and our more than 1,600 law school alumni in mourning the loss of former Orlando City Commissioner Daisy Lynum , who led the effort to bring the re-established law school to Parramore . She was a visionary , and we are indebted to her for foreshadowing our future as a resource in the Parramore , downtown Orlando , and broader community . We extend our condolences to the Lynum family , including Edward Juan Lynum , a member of the inaugural graduating class of 2005 .”

The FAMU College of Law is located in the heart of Downtown Orlando , just steps from the George C . Young United States Courthouse and Federal Building ; and blocks from governmental offices , major law firms , large corporations and legal service agencies .
The college ’ s prime location provides students with direct access to the area ’ s largest employers of individuals with law degrees , offering our students and graduates ample avenues to gain practical experience in the legal profession .
With tuition among the lowest of the law schools in Florida , along with a full-time day program and a part-time evening program , the college is distinctly positioned to offer the traditional student and the working professional a chance to earn a law degree while accruing minimal debt .
Thanks to its renowned faculty , the college focuses on academic excellence in the classroom ; emphasizes practical experience and public service within its clinical programs ; and stresses professionalism through its co-curricular activities .
